6.3 Communication

The OX400 has RS232 serial communication as standard. Oxygen concentration, alarm, and

error information are transmitted via this communication. The following shows the communication

specifications.

• Communication Specifications

Table 6.1

Communication Specifications

Item

Description

Communication method

One-way (transmission only), asynchronous

Data format

ASCII

Baud rate

38400 bps

Data length

8-bit

Parity

None

Stop bit

1-bit

Flow control

None
